In the center of Meghe Dhaka Tara, Ranen Roychoudhury appears as the folk singer whose slow sway and arching features evoke a quiet transcendence. His sweet, lilting cries peel back the cruelty of the melodrama and present the beating heart of Ritwik Ghatak’s humanism.
